Ragamuffins Coffeehouse is an interior and exterior renovation project in downtown Laurel, Maryland. As a coffee shop, and “third place”, Ragamuffins adds to the local economy during the week, serving specialty coffee beverages, literature, and food, while functioning as a place for worship and community activities on weekends and evenings. The design includes a new storefront and canopy system on the front facade, redefining the aesthetics and creating a more welcoming entrance. A warm, industrial feel has been created by using salvaged brick on the interior, and supplementing with the use of stainless steel, glass, rustic factory light fixtures, and refinished existing wood floors for an eclectic vintage-modern feel. Fresh furniture, fabrics, and colors help provide a comfortable environment for coffee-goers and meet-up groups.
